Clockwork MAX RIG® Reflect x HK – Ski/Snowboard Goggles
Product Description
The Clockwork MAX RIG® Reflect Goggle is part of Henrik Kristoffersen’s Signature Line with Sweet Protection, designed for elite performance on and off the race course. The MAX model features an 11% size increase over the standard Clockwork, offering enhanced field of vision with dimensions of 103mm in height and 191mm in width.
Equipped with a premium 2.8mm toric sculpted lens and Sweet Protection’s proprietary RIG® lens technology, the goggles deliver excellent contrast, reduced color distortion, and lower eye fatigue. The double lens design incorporates a GORE® Protective Vent to equalize pressure and prevent lens deformation due to altitude changes, maintaining clear, undistorted vision.
The inner lens features advanced Clear AF anti-fog technology, offering triple the effectiveness of standard anti-fog systems. Super oleophobic and hydrophobic coatings repel water, dirt, and grime, ensuring maximum clarity in all conditions.
Designed to match perfectly with the Volata 2Vi® Mips Race Helmet and Trooper 2Vi® Mips Helmet – both also part of Henrik’s Signature Line – these goggles are built for top-tier athletes and serious enthusiasts.
